7 Navy SEALs punished for consulting on 'Medal of Honor' game
(Chicago) Tribune staff and wire reports ^ | November 9, 2012

Posted on 11/09/2012 7:35:56 AM PST by ConservativeStatement

Seven members of the secretive Navy SEAL Team 6, including one involved in the mission to get Osama bin Laden, have been punished for disclosing classified information, senior Navy officials said.

The seven received letters of reprimand and forfeited half of their pay for two months after a Navy investigation found they had served as paid consultants to the designers of “Medal of Honor Warfighter,” one official said.
